Foremost, it's crucial to understand the robust build and materials that distinguish a top-tier deep well submersible pump. Stainless steel is often the material of choice, prized for its resilience against the corrosive properties inherent in deep water conditions. It resists rust, ensuring longevity and consistent performance. For unparalleled durability, ensure that the pump you choose offers high-grade seals and bearings — the unsung heroes that keep the system running smoothly by preventing water ingress into the motor housing.
From a functional standpoint, depth capacity and flow rate are pivotal specifications to scrutinize. Selecting a pump capable of reaching the depth of your well while delivering the desired water volume is non-negotiable. It's not merely about hitting the demand but doing so during peak needs without compromising efficiency. Pumps boasting high flow rates per horsepower are often more energy-efficient, translating to long-term savings on operating costs.
Equally vital is the pump's motor technology. Modern advances have seen the introduction of highly efficient motors with thermal protection features. These innovative designs mitigate the risk of overheating, prolonging the motor's lifespan and ensuring reliable operation under variable conditions. Look for models that offer dual power modes, allowing seamless transitions between AC and solar power sources — a critical feature for remote or off-grid installations.

Authoritativeness in the deep well submersible pump market also involves embracing innovation. Variable speed technologies, for instance, adjust the pump's flow rate based on real-time water demand, optimizing energy usage and minimizing wear and tear. This technology not only enhances performance but aligns with eco-friendly practices, a growing concern among environment-conscious consumers.
Furthermore, practical experience reveals that installation and system integration are critical factors often underestimated. A pump's compatibility with existing systems can affect both its performance and lifespan. Consulting with professionals ensures seamless installation and can preclude common pitfalls, such as mismatched components or inadequate power supply that might lead to system failures or inefficiencies.
